What was the nature of the advice Maharaj gave to his followers, and why was it structured that way?

Maharaj's advice was primarily ethical rather than focused on profound Vedanta subjects or discourses on the Upanishads. According to chapter 0, his method followed the Sadguru's scriptural practice of first purifying the disciple's ground before sowing the seed of knowledge. This is why his teachings centered on general ethical principles. Many devotees came to him with worldly desires, and he would satisfy those desires first, then seamlessly turn their minds toward the path of ultimate welfare. The text emphasizes that his incarnation was for the salvation of all people.
